NVIDIA L40 48 GB cloud GPU for rent

Datacenter · Ada Lovelace architecture

The L40 is the datacenter Ada card built for visualisation and inference: 48 GB GDDR6, 18,176 CUDA cores, passively cooled at 300 W. It shares silicon with the L40S at slightly lower clocks, making it a cheaper 48 GB option for render farms and SDXL serving.

A server-class card built for sustained 24/7 load: passive cooling in proper chassis, ECC memory, and drivers validated for compute. The sweet spot for inference fleets and fine-tuning jobs that need stability more than headline FLOPS.

NVIDIA L40 specs: VRAM, TFLOPS, bandwidth

GPU modelNVIDIA L40 ArchitectureAda Lovelace (2022)
VRAM48 GB GDDR6 Memory bandwidth864 GB/s
FP16 tensor perf.181 TFLOPS FP32 perf.90.5 TFLOPS
CUDA cores18,176 TDP300 W
PowerScore (RTX 3090 = 100)127 PCIe generationGen 4.0
Multi-GPU1× – 4× Max instance storage4,000 GB NVMe
Network up to10,000 Mbps CUDA12.4 – 13.0

Bandwidth, CUDA cores, TDP and FP32 are public NVIDIA figures; FP16 tensor is the dense (non-sparsity) number. Machine-level values come from live inventory.

What you can run on a L40 (48 GB VRAM)

With 48 GB of GDDR6, a single card holds a ~14B-parameter LLM in FP16 or up to ~72B parameters quantized to 4-bit, with room for KV-cache at practical context lengths. Scale to 4× GPUs on one machine for bigger models or bigger batches — the per-GPU price stays $0.234.
